Grid-Tie Inverters: The Smart Hub of Modern Solar Energy Systems

Grid-Tie Inverters: The Smart Hub of Modern Solar Energy Systems

You know that feeling when your smartphone seamlessly switches between Wi-Fi and cellular data? Grid-tie inverters work similarly as the brain of solar energy systems, constantly balancing power flow between solar panels and the utility grid. These devices convert DC electricity from solar panels into AC power that's synchronized with grid frequency (typically 60Hz in North America).
